了解HTML5
HTML5,作为网页设计的最新标准,自2014年正式发布以来,已经成为了网页开发的主流技术。它不仅包含了之前HTML版本的所有特性,还引入了许多新特性,如本地存储、图形绘制、多媒体嵌入等,使得网页开发更加便捷和高效。
HTML5的优势
- 跨平台兼容性:HTML5在各种设备上都能良好运行,包括桌面电脑、平板电脑和智能手机。
- 丰富的多媒体支持:HTML5支持音频、视频等多媒体元素,无需额外插件即可播放。
- 离线应用支持:通过HTML5的离线应用缓存功能,用户可以在没有网络连接的情况下访问网页应用。
- 更强大的图形和动画能力:HTML5引入了Canvas和SVG等图形绘制技术,使得网页动画和游戏开发成为可能。
从零开始学习HTML5
第一步:了解HTML5的基本结构
HTML5的基本结构如下:
<!DOCTYPE html>
<html>
<head>
<title>网页标题</title>
</head>
<body>
<!-- 网页内容 -->
</body>
</html>
第二步:学习HTML5的常用标签
HTML5提供了丰富的标签,以下是一些常用的标签:
<h1>至<h6>:标题标签<p>:段落标签<a>:超链接标签<img>:图片标签<video>:视频标签<audio>:音频标签
第三步:学习HTML5的新特性
- 本地存储:通过
localStorage和sessionStorage,可以实现在不刷新页面的情况下存储数据。 - Canvas:使用Canvas标签可以绘制图形、动画和游戏。
- SVG:SVG是一种基于可扩展标记语言的矢量图形,可以绘制高质量的图形和动画。
- 表单元素:HTML5新增了许多表单元素,如
<input type="email">、<input type="date">等,提高了表单的可用性和用户体验。
制作互动网页
第一步:设计网页布局
在设计网页布局时,可以使用HTML5的CSS框架,如Bootstrap,来快速搭建响应式网页。
第二步:添加互动元素
- 动画:使用CSS3的动画和过渡效果,可以使网页更具吸引力。
- JavaScript:通过JavaScript,可以实现网页的交互功能,如验证表单、动态加载内容等。
- WebGL:WebGL是一种3D图形API,可以实现在网页中渲染3D图形和动画。
第三步:测试和优化
在完成网页制作后,需要对网页进行测试和优化,确保网页在不同设备和浏览器上都能正常显示。
总结
学习HTML5,可以帮助你制作出更加丰富、互动的网页。通过本文的介绍,相信你已经对HTML5有了初步的了解。接下来,你需要不断实践,掌握HTML5的各项技术,才能成为一名优秀的网页开发者。祝你在HTML5的世界里,探索出一片属于自己的天地!
